Pre-Construction Coordinator

Stevenage - Remote

Starting Salary: Up to £37.5K

Role Summary

Our client, a a market leading supplier of ICP & EV Infrastructure is on the look out to add an experienced Pre-Construction Manager to their team. This client has gone through huge growth over the past 6 years and are on course to add another 60 heads to their team in 2024. You will be a focal point for both current and new customers.

Duties

  • Attend pot- award project hand overs from the tendering team, accepting responsibility for the project going into pre-construction, understanding the commercial and design requirements.
  • Instructing and coordinating designs throughout the pre-construction program, designs will vary from ICP, EV, Civils and Electrical.
  • Reviewing design received, ensuring they are feasible, designed as instructed and commercially viable against the original budget.
  • Attend Client meetings as and when required.
  • Issuing RFIs to customers in order to obtain all required information to enable the pre-construction design to commence.
  • Apply for MPANs and unmetered supply form where necessary.
  • Updating trackers and project folders and communicating any changes set by key stakeholders.
  • Assist the Project Managers with pre-construction and construction design queries/changes & instructing design variations as required.
  • Liaising with design teams and DNOs/IDNOs in order to progress the projects.

Requirements

  • An understanding of the ICP / EV / HV sector is advantageous
  • Understanding of DNO / IDNO requirements for installations up to 11KV.
  • Knowledge of design and pre-construction processes
  • Must be well organised and able to manage multiple projects & workloads.
  • Ability to adapt and open to change.
  • Experience in updating trackers.
